Output c9939dd9493ecf3e9683bab3ea09f8256a1749bf35aa555429d5a82c26a425bf:392

value
626313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 930d36aac568b00787142c1da500ee16f85eabc4 OP_EQUAL
address
MMJhPirCzkBEAYfwmSZk6TciTbJn9ULAww
transaction
c9939dd9493ecf3e9683bab3ea09f8256a1749bf35aa555429d5a82c26a425bf
spent
false